President Donald Trump admitted he had ‘no thought’ what led Vladimir Putin to escalate the battle with Ukraine in a scathing takedown of the Russian chief.

Trump used to be requested to offer an replace at the battle in Ukraine on Sunday as he departed his Bedminster golfing membership to go back to Washington. 

‘Yeah, I’ll provide you with an replace. I’m no longer pleased with what Putin’s doing,’ Trump stated at the tarmac of Morristown Airport. ‘He’s killing a large number of other people.

‘I do not know what the hell came about to Putin. I’ve identified him a very long time. Always gotten together with him. But he is sending rockets into towns and killing other people.

‘We’re in the course of speaking and he is capturing rockets into Kyiv and different towns. I do not love it in any respect… I do not know what is improper with him.’

Trump stated he used to be ‘completely’ now bearing in mind extra sanctions on Russia because of Putin’s conduct. 

The president had spoken with Putin at the telephone for 2 hours on Monday – however in the end the ones conversations didn’t result in a ceasefire. 

Instead, Russia persisted to assault Ukraine during the weekend, launching the unmarried biggest aerial assault of the battle thus far in an immediate insult to Trump’s efforts at mediation.

At least 12 had been reported lifeless and 57 injured.

Among the lifeless had been a minimum of 3 kids within the northern area of Zhytomyr, native officers stated. 

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skiy had known as at the United States and Trump to sentence the assault. 

‘The silence of America, the silence of others on this planet best encourages Putin,’ he wrote on Telegram.

‘Every such terrorist Russian strike is explanation why sufficient for brand new sanctions towards Russia.’

Trump were in large part silent at the battle whilst he spent portions of Saturday and Sunday at his New Jersey golfing membership. 

Saturday morning he visited the United States Military Academy at West Point to ship a graduation deal with.

But on his approach house, the president used to be additionally requested a few declare made via a Russian commander that Putin’s helicopter virtually were given stuck in the course of a Ukrainian drone assault.

‘I have never heard that,’ Trump answered, speculating that ‘possibly that might be a explanation why’ for the fatal assault.

‘I do not know, however I’ve no longer heard that,’ the president added. 

The newest assault marks the second one large-scale attack on Ukraine in two nights, and the 3rd in every week. 

Ukraine’s air drive stated Sunday that Russia had introduced 69 ballistic and cruise missiles, together with 298 assault drones, with about two-thirds of the missiles and drones shot down. 

Interior Minister Ihor Klymenko stated: ‘This used to be a mixed, ruthless strike aimed toward civilians. The enemy as soon as once more confirmed that its objective is worry and loss of life.’

U.S. Special Envoy to Ukraine Keith Kellogg stated on Sunday the assault used to be ‘a transparent violation’ of the 1977 Geneva Peace Protocols and known as for a direct ceasefire. 

The newest carnage provides to rising proof that some distance from taking steps in opposition to peace – as Trump has demanded – Putin is engaged in ever more potent assaults on Ukraine most likely as a prelude to a significant summer season offensive searching for to seize new territory in on Kharkiv, Sumy and Dnipro areas starting subsequent month.

Up to 50,000 Russian troops are being ready for an advance, in keeping with reviews.
